COMMERCIAL DESCRIPTION
Belgo-Scottish "wee heavy" ale, big malty-sweet and complex beer brewed with a Belgian yeast strain to give it a distinct fruity characer.

UPDATED: FEB 21, 2010 Draft, served in tulip glass. Sweet caramel and yeast aroma. Dark brown amber body with medium head that thins quickly and lingers, nice lacing. The flavor is overall sweet due to the Belgian yeast, with light caramel and malts. well balanced and smooth with hints of spice and citrus. A finish with a nice warming power..

Cask on Lancaster Brewpub. Pours a mud colored brown with a creamy tan head. Aroma of fruity ale esters. Medium bodied with creamy and chewy texture, soft carbonation. Flavor of wet grains, brown sugar, and plums- with residual sweetness. Tobacco and small amount of pepperiness on the finish- with detectable alcohol that blends in. This has some phenols that are similar to ones found in Belgian quads. Interesting

Draft @ BCTC. Pours a dark, murky brown color with golden edges; thin off-white head. Tea, brown sugar, basic wet malts and cereal in the aroma; kind of bland, cereal-dominated. Medium-to-full mouthfeel: chewy caramel and brown sugar maltiness upfront; nicely chewy, dense maltiness; toasty grains; slightly heavy and dense on the palate; reasonably big scottish rendition. Lengthy finish: brown sugar, toasted malts, cola, and dried dark fruits.
